Expert Review
The opportunity to work with DoorDash as a delivery driver offers considerable flexibility. Dashers can choose when and where to work, making it perfect for those with other commitments. Earnings vary based on demand and location, so it's important to be aware of this variability before committing.
While the role does not require prior experience, drivers must have a reliable mode of transport and be prepared for the costs associated with vehicle upkeep. The lack of benefits such as health insurance and paid leave can deter those seeking more stable employment.
Customer feedback suggests that while many appreciate the freedom, they also highlight the challenges of inconsistent income. According to DoorDash's site, drivers can earn more during peak hours or busy events, so strategic timing is key.
this position is great for those who prioritise flexibility over stability. If you're looking for a consistent paycheck, this may not be the best fit.
